Most powerful ways to connect LinkedIn Data Scraper and OpenAI Responses
LinkedIn Data Scraper + OpenAI Responses + Slack: This automation scrapes LinkedIn for job titles using the 'Search Jobs' action, then leverages OpenAI to generate personalized connection messages for potential candidates. Finally, the generated messages and candidate information are posted to a designated Slack channel for review and further action.
Google Sheets + OpenAI Responses + LinkedIn Data Scraper: This flow starts with interview questions stored in Google Sheets. When a new row is added to the sheet (representing a new question), OpenAI generates variations of the question. Then, LinkedIn Data Scraper searches for candidates with specific skills and logs candidate details, together with the original and generated question, back into Google Sheets.

Are there any limitations to the LinkedIn Data Scraper and OpenAI Responses integration on Latenode?
While the integration is powerful, there are certain limitations to be aware of:
- Rate limits imposed by LinkedIn and OpenAI may affect the volume of data processed.
- The accuracy of OpenAI Responses depends on the quality of the scraped data.
- Changes to LinkedIn's website structure may require adjustments to the scraper.
